Our lab adopt Solid Phase Synthesis Method to synthesize peptides. Materials and reagents needed in the process are as follows:
Materials
Fmoc-Pro-OH
Fmoc-Ala-OH
Fmoc-Lys(Boc)-OH
Fmoc-Leu-OH
Fmoc-Arg(pbf)-OH
Fmoc-Val-OH
Fmoc-Glu(OtBu)-OH
Fmoc-AA Wang Resin
HOBt
DIC
DIEA
Etc.
Reagent K
[TFA: H 2 O: thioanisole: ethanedithiol; phenol 85:5:5:2.5:2.5]
